WebThese penetrating properties make terahertz imaging attractive for materials analysis, industrial non-destructive testing, and security screening. Terahertz will pass through fabric and plastics but be strongly absorbed by metals, creating contrast in the image. It is equally appealing for biomedical applications because it can penetrate ...
